To provide a relay function which ensures continuous network connection in an interrupted wireless communication network.
A wireless communication mechanism is loaded with relay support between base stations (BS), relay support between mobile stations (MS), and relay support between a mobile station and a base station, in a medium access control (MAC) layer. In the relay support between the base stations, an initial BS sends a request message to an adjacent station, determines which response to acknowledge when plural messages are received, and sends a confirmation message after the determination. Receiving the confirmation, a response BS updates a status, creates a super frame header (SFH) and an HR-MAP for the next station and transmits an HR preamble, the SFH, and the HR-MAP for the next station.
